Car Mechanic Simulator 2018: Deep Garage-Building on the Go

Car Mechanic Simulator 2018 is one of the standout Steam Deck free titles this week. Available on Steam as a “free to keep” offer if you redeem it by May 27, it’s already tagged as playable on Deck, making it a safe grab for handheld mechanics-in-training. The game puts you in charge of a growing garage, letting you diagnose issues, replace parts, and rebuild cars from the frame up. It’s a natural fit for portable sessions—tackle a repair job while commuting, or methodically restore a classic over a few evenings. The layered systems and methodical pace create a satisfying loop that works well on a smaller screen. For fans of simulation and management, this is one of the best handheld gaming deals right now, giving you a full-featured sim that feels at home in portable play bursts.

Warhammer 40,000: Gladius Brings Grimdark Strategy to Your Lap

Strategy fans get a major freebie with Warhammer 40,000: Gladius – Relics of War, currently free to keep on Steam if you redeem it by May 28. Listed as Verified for Steam Deck, Gladius translates well to handheld play, letting you wage turn-based war in the grimdark future from your couch or bed. As a 4X-style strategy game, it focuses heavily on combat and faction asymmetry, making each run feel distinct whether you’re commanding Space Marines, Orks, or other iconic armies. The deliberate pacing and turn-based structure are perfect for portable sessions, where you can play a few turns, suspend, and pick up later without losing the thread. If you’ve been waiting for a tactical Warhammer title that fits into your handheld routine, Gladius is an easy recommendation among this week’s free game bundles.

Tomb Raider 1–3 Remastered and Down in Bermuda on Epic

Epic Games is adding serious value for handheld players this week with two notable freebies: Down in Bermuda and Tomb Raider 1–3 Remastered, both free to keep when claimed in time. While they’re not native to Steam, you can bring them to Steam Deck via the Heroic launcher or similar third-party tools. Down in Bermuda offers a relaxed, puzzle-driven adventure that works nicely in short bursts—ideal for quick handheld sessions. Tomb Raider 1–3 Remastered, meanwhile, bundles three iconic action-adventure classics in a refreshed package, giving you a portable tour through Lara Croft’s early adventures at no cost. Together, they showcase how non-Steam storefronts significantly expand the pool of free Steam Deck games. With a bit of setup, these titles slide into your handheld rotation just as easily as any native Steam release.

Amazon Prime and GOG: Extra Free Game Bundles for Handhelds

If you’re subscribed to Amazon Prime, this week’s lineup extends beyond Steam and Epic into GOG and additional launchers. Using Heroic or another third-party tool, you can bring GOG titles like Palindrome Syndrome: Escape Room, Space Grunts, and Hot Brass onto your Steam Deck or similar devices, all listed as free to keep when redeemed before their respective deadlines. On top of that, Amazon Prime Gaming is offering more free games such as Survival: Fountain of Youth and Deep Sky Derelicts, both playable on handhelds. These promotions highlight how weekly free game bundles can continually refresh your portable library with strategy, survival, puzzle, and action experiences. By checking these giveaways regularly and redeeming everything you might eventually play, you can build a varied handheld backlog that keeps your Deck busy without ever dipping into your wallet.
